Guacamelee! Super Turbo Championship Edition (360, Xbox One, Wii U, PS4)

GUACA_BOXJuan is a humble Mexican farmer, but one day while helping prepare for his village’s Day of the Dead festivities, a group of evil skeletons kidnaps El Presidente’s daughter, who is also Juan’s childhood friend.    These skeletons, led by the evil Calaca, plan to merge the world of the dead with the world of the living, and they kill Juan before he can rescue the girl.  Stuck in the world of the dead, Juan finds a mysterious mask.  When he puts it on, he becomes a strong and powerful Luchador.  The guardian of the mask, a lady named Tostada, tells Juan that the mask not only gives him the power of a Luchador, but will also allow him to return to the world of the living so he can rescue El Presidente’s daughter, defeat Calaca and his minions, and save both worlds in the process.  I don’t know what is different in the Super Turbo Championship Edition of Guacamelee, since I never played the original, but this downloadable game is a 2-D action platformer with Metroid-style exploration and combo-based fighting gameplay (360 version reviewed here).

Marvel Pinball: Deadpool (360)

DEADPOOL_BOXEveryone’s favorite “Merc With a Mouth,” Deadpool, is bouncing of the comic book pages and into his own pinball game.  His table features all the madcap nonsense and crazy humor you’d expect from Marvel’s most wisecracking superhero (and sometimes villain).  You can download and play it on consoles that support Zen Studios’ pinball games and PC, but it’s reviewed on 360 here.

Photos With Mario (3DS)

PHOTOMARIO1The last thing we’ll look at in our “Free-to-Play” Week is an application for 3DS that you can download on the eShop for free.  It’ll let you take photos of Mario characters using cards, similar to how the AR Games functions on your 3DS.  But while the Photos With Mario app is free, the way you get the cards isn’t.  You have to buy special Nintendo Points cards that have the Mario cards included, and you can only buy them at Target stores.

Moshling Rescue (iPad)

MOSHLING_BOXIt’s “Free-to-Play” week here at GamerDad.com, where we’ll look at three games that won’t cost you anything to play (well, sort of).  Anyway, Moshi Monsters is a popular online virtual pet simulator where players take care of various cute monsters and their Moshling pets, as well as play games and have adventures.  And now the Moshlings are starring in their own match-three puzzle game, which plays similar to other titles like Bejeweled and Candy Crush.  It’s free to play and available on Facebook and iOS devices (reviewed on iPad here).
